Transaction 14d0cd222aa4619cf95d0c9a8b05481159f6cc340a031d1480e508afea964835
1 Input
1 Output
-
14d0cd222aa4619cf95d0c9a8b05481159f6cc340a031d1480e508afea964835:0
- value
- 25059085
- script pubkey
- OP_0 OP_PUSHBYTES_20 e423e2a62cfd82259def511ba0cc9b43a1542d82
- address
- bc1qus379f3vlkpzt8002yd6pnymgws4gtvzc5pdqc